Course Content

• Energy Economics and Market Design
• Energy Finance and Investment Appraisal (including discounted cash flow analysis, risk assessment, and financial modeling)
• Policy Instruments for Renewable Energy Deployment (subsidies, feed-in tariffs, carbon pricing)
• Regulatory Frameworks for Energy Investments (licensing, permitting, grid access)
• Geopolitics of Energy and Investment Risk
• Sustainable Energy Investment and ESG (Environmental, Social, and Governance) factors
• Climate Change Policy and its Impact on Energy Investments
• Energy Transition and Portfolio Diversification Strategies
• Due Diligence and Transaction Management in Energy Investments

Career path

Career Role Description
Energy Policy Analyst Develop and analyze energy policies, focusing on investment strategies and regulatory frameworks. Expertise in renewable energy and carbon reduction is highly valued.
Renewable Energy Investment Manager Manage investment portfolios in renewable energy projects, assessing risk and return within the UK market. Strong financial modeling skills are essential.
Energy Finance Specialist Structure and execute financing for energy projects, including debt and equity financing. Experience in green bonds and sustainable finance is beneficial.
Sustainability Consultant (Energy Focus) Advise clients on energy efficiency, carbon footprint reduction, and sustainable investment opportunities. Deep understanding of ESG (Environmental, Social, and Governance) factors is key.
Energy Market Analyst Analyze energy markets, forecasting trends and providing insights to support investment decisions. Strong data analysis and modeling skills are required.
